Live and work in one of NZ's most adventurous and pristine regions Advance your career whilst enjoying a quality work-life balance About The Role: With an enviable climate, laid-back lifestyle, and friendly community environment, the Buller district is a great place to live, work, and enjoy.
Buller has so much to offer.
You will be surrounded by national parks, beautiful beaches, and an abundance of outdoor activities.
Stretching from Punakaiki in the south to Karamea in the north, and inland as far as Springs Junction, the district is home to a population of just over 9,500, and the 8,574 square km's boasts two national parks, one forest park, and two heritage areas.

About the Organisation: The Buller District Council is the territorial authority for the northern West Coast.
Council's goal is to promote the well-being of its local communities.
It has a wide range of responsibilities under the Local Government Act.
Council's mission is to serve the residents of the Buller district, conscious of their needs, by providing facilities and services and creating an appropriate environment for progress and development; while preserving the distinctive natural environment, as well as the cultural and historical environments.
Council consists of 11 elected members, the Mayor and 10 Councillors and an Iwi Representative from Ngati Waewae.
Council's role is to provide local leadership and facilitate the delivery of services and activities that promote community well-being throughout the Buller District.
Council provides leadership relating to issues that affect the community, through the management of the environment and promotion of the District's needs and aspirations.
It ensures that the district's infrastructural assets and associated resources are utilised and managed in a responsible way for the benefit of residents and ratepayers both today and in the future.
